Replacement headlamp assembly?
Just bought a '97 SS. The one thing I don't like about older cars are the headlamps. I'm used to HID's and would like similar clarity, instead of the standard dim yellow. Has anyone found any HID replacements? I'm talking about true HID's (with ballasts), not the bulbs that PIAA claims to be HID; I've had them in the past. They're nice, compared to standard, however do not compare to true xenon.

RE: Replacement headlamp assembly?
I bought the housings from eurolamps.com. Same as stock, but bulbs are held in by a clip at the back. You don't even need to do that though. You can just twist your old bulbs out of the housing, and use some sealant to secure the new ones into place. As for the ballasts, I just hung them from each side of the engine bay's hood stops/rests.
